零知识证明、CoinJoin、同态加密、安全多方计算及隐私合约架构共同构建DeFi隐私体系:分别实现交易验证隐藏、地址关联切断、密文运算、协同计算不泄露输入、逻辑封装防信息泄露。

币圈加密货币主流交易平台官网注册地址推荐:
Binance币安:
欧易OKX:
火币htx:
Gateio芝麻开门:
一、零知识证明技术应用
零知识证明允许验证者确认某项陈述为真,而无需获知陈述的具体内容。在DeFi中,该技术用于隐藏交易金额、资产类型及参与方身份,同时保持链上可验证性。
1、用户在前端界面选择需隐私化的交易资产与目标协议。
2、系统调用ZK-SNARKs电路生成证明,对原始交易参数进行加密压缩。
3、智能合约仅验证证明有效性,不读取原始输入数据,完成状态变更。
4、验证通过后,交易哈希写入主网,但链上浏览器无法解析金额与路径信息。
二、CoinJoin混合机制
CoinJoin通过将多个用户的输入合并为一笔交易输出,切断地址与资金流向的直接映射关系。该方式不依赖可信第三方,所有参与者共同签名达成共识。
1、用户向Unijoin.io等协议提交相同面额的代币至临时混币池。
2、系统等待足够数量参与者加入,触发批量交易构造流程。
3、各用户指定独立的接收地址,系统生成单笔多输出交易广播至链上。
4、交易确认后,原始输入地址与最终接收地址之间无确定性关联路径。
三、同态加密计算层
同态加密使智能合约能在密文状态下执行加法、乘法等运算,确保敏感数值(如抵押率、清算阈值)全程不暴露明文。
1、用户端使用公钥对本地资产余额、债务数据进行加密并上传。
2、DeFi协议合约调用同态运算模块处理加密参数,生成加密结果。
3、结果返回用户端后,使用私钥解密获得实际数值,完成风控判定。
4、整个过程链上仅留存密文交互记录,原始数值未进入EVM执行环境。
四、安全多方计算协同验证
安全多方计算允许多个参与方联合执行计算任务,各自输入保持本地化,仅共享最终结果。适用于跨协议隐私清算与联合风险建模场景。
1、多个借贷协议节点各自持有本地用户的负债与抵押数据密文。
2、节点间启动SMC协议,协商生成联合随机掩码并分发局部计算任务。
3、各节点在本地完成掩码运算后,广播加密中间值至协调合约。
4、协调合约聚合加密中间值并触发最终解密,输出清算决策而不暴露任一节点原始数据。
五、隐私智能合约部署架构
隐私智能合约将ZKP验证逻辑、密钥管理模块与业务逻辑封装于单一合约实例中,避免外部调用泄露上下文信息。
1、开发者使用Circom或Noir编写隐私逻辑电路,并编译为Solidity兼容验证器。
2、将验证器合约与业务逻辑合约通过内联汇编方式绑定,禁用外部直接读取状态变量。
3、部署时启用EIP-1167最小代理模式,隔离每个用户会话的临时状态存储。
4、合约接口仅开放verifyAndExecute函数,强制所有操作经ZKP校验路径执行。









